I went to "winding road" and they have a couple helmets with SA2015 certification on sale.
I was looking for an inexpensive full face beginners lid... They have a G-Force model GF 3 at $250.
Free shipping, no tax.
Taking a chance this works.
Please, no push back on what company makes a better one.
If its not up to my expectation I will return it - fit, quality, etc.
For two track days a year I likely don't need the gold standard.

As long as it fits right and meets the spec the track requires then your good.
In my mind, the problem arises when someone buys a cheap one because of money even though it doesn't fit quite right.
